The Galveston Planning Commission on May 6 deferred an abandonment request, approved three license-to-use requests or permits, recorded one withdrawal, and recommended a text amendment to add a historic corner-store parcel to the San Jacinto list for City Council consideration.

At its May 6 meeting the Galveston Planning Commission took the following formal actions (motions and outcomes):

25P-015 — Abandonment request (adjacent to 30330 First Street): Staff requested and the commission approved a deferral to the May 20, 2025 meeting so the applicant could provide additional information and respond to staff comments. The deferral was approved unanimously. Public speakers including Roslyn Jackson and Lillian McGrew opposed full abandonment of the alley, saying the alley supports local businesses and community activities.
